LCD Laminating: Techniques & Troubleshooting

LCD adhering is a essential operation in display production, requiring precise approach to guarantee superior picture performance. Common methods include vacuum laminating and roll-to-roll equipment. Troubleshooting typical difficulties like voids, separation, or uneven bonding often requires complete inspection of surface treatment, glue selection, and bonding value modification. Maintaining consistent ambient conditions, such as heat and humidity, is also essential for successful results.

Understanding LCD Lamination Processes

LCD display lamination methods involve precisely positioning a thin-film crystal panel to a cover film. This essential step typically uses custom devices and precise control of elements such as heat, force, and dampness. Various methods, including continuous and individual processes, are utilized depending on the volume and kind OCA bonding machine of display being created. Achieving a defect-free connection guarantees the optimal image quality and longevity of the finished product.
